## Deployment: Upgrading the Broker

Welcome aboard. The Quillfort platform uses the Merrowbus message broker, and upgrades must be done one node at a time to keep quorum. Drain the node in the Tallowgate console, wait for partition handoff to complete, then install the new package and rejoin. Never upgrade two nodes in the same rack window, even if the release notes claim compatibility. Before you begin, verify your local settings match the cluster baseline, which is reproduced below for reference.

settings of tagef-bawif:
DRUIX_HOST=druix.zemvarlabs.internal
DRUIX_PORT=8000

### Step 6 — Pin the toolchain

With Hollowforge, every compiler, linker, and codegen tool must be declared explicitly; nothing is taken from the host anymore. Replace the old PATH-based lookups in the build scripts with pinned toolchain references, then run the hermeticity checker to confirm no ambient dependencies remain. Builds will fail loudly on any undeclared input, which is expected at first. The toolchain pins the sync agreed on are listed below.

deployment values, kajep-kageg:
[praix]
host = praix.paliqcorp.corp
user = praix_svc
database = praix_prod

Changelog v2.9.1 — Tilecrest Image Cache. Fixed a memory leak where evicted thumbnails retained decoder handles, growing heap usage roughly 40 MB/hour under load. As part of this fix, the setting CACHE_PURGE_KEY was renamed to EVICTION_AUTH_TOKEN to reflect that it now also authorizes the new forced-eviction endpoint. Security reviewers should confirm the old variable is removed from all deployments, as it is no longer read. The renamed secret is set on the line below.

vault entry, yahif-yajep: COURIER_KEY29=b802bdf8034096b65a51c6ba5abe2